Basics Of Soccer

Published by admin under Timed Finals

Soccer rules aren’t difficult to understand, and the simplest rule is that the team that scores the most goals during the game wins.  Soccer is a simple game with easy rules to understand.  The size of the ground is 200 yards and breadth is 100 yards.  Referee in the game ensures that all the players observe the set rules.

A soccer game lasts for two separate periods, and every half lasts for forty-five minutes.  As per official soccer rules, each team can have ten outfield players and one goalkeeper on the field.  The number of players on the bench can vary but, substitutions in official competition games are only three substitutions per team.  While the game is on, referee has the power to issue red and yellow cards, and likewise caution to the players. For minor or series of fouls, a yellow card is issued, and two issued yellow cards is like a red card, sending the offending footballer off the field. 

One very common formation for a team is to have 4 players in the midfield, and two strikers to create and score the goals, and another 4 player at the back defending they’re own goal, this type of formation is callled 4-4-2 and is pretty common, although there are many other types of formation chosen by the coachs. One of the main factors that will influence the chosen formation is the study that the coach those regarding the opponent team. 

For a team to win the score of that team has to be higher of the score of the opponent team, so a goal is granted when the ball has wholly crossed the white line or goal, irrespective of whether or not it’s in the air or on the ground, a goal is scored.  In the professional soccer game, the goal scoring is normally low and most matches are determined by only one or two goals.
Soccer coaches and specialists have developed completely different tactics and strategies to improve the defensive and offensive tactics of the game. 

Free kicks are granted when the player of 1 team tries to grab the ball from the player of  the opponent team but somehow misses and ends up making contact with the player of the other team, the referee considers this as a foul and awards a free kick to the fouled team. If the fould accured with the goal keeper box then this becomes a penalty kick, in which case chances of scoring are greatly increased as there is no wall or player between the goalkeeper and the player who’s about to kick the penalty.

Most people feel that the offside rule of soccer is very complicated, difficult and hard to understand. A player will be in offside if he is nearer to the opponent’s goal line than the ball and second remaining opponent.  Offside rule has resulted in many controversies and debates, and interpretation by the referee can determine the winner of the game.  There’s a rectangular space in front of the goal, and if the referee feels that a foul has occurred by a player of defense within this area as mentioned above, a penalty kick is awarded.   A simple offside rule states that offensive participant cannot go {aheadbehind} of the defense while the play develops.

Soccer Practice Games: Secrets Revealed

Published by admin under Gymnastics

Soccer practice games

Have you ever imagined the kind of advantages soccer practice games give the players? In addition to hundreds of opportunities to touch the ball, the players have adequate room to try out other maneuvers.

In soccer training, a 4v4 small-sided game is set up in a small area and is beneficial not only to the coach but also to the players. The coach is in a position to observe all players on one side since they are only 4 in count. There is a lot of time available to the players for the purpose of playing with the game. Also, it allows the players to practice the process of distribution - collecting the ball, looking up, and taking quick decisions.

It’s the responsibility of the coach to push the kids to utilize the above procedure by remaining present on the ground. The kids may not get familiarized to it easily especially in the beginning. For example, they might try to apply the usual technique of kick and run. It’s absolutely ok. However, you will need to teach them the various ways they can employ the process of distribution.

If required, make use of diagram to teach the process to the players to begin with. After that you must demonstrate it also. Be a little persistent and the kids will find it easy to accept and follow it. After they begin utilizing the process, they’ll try to make the best use of the available space when they have the ball.

Soccer Training

As a result of it, the team’s game gets a sort of constitution. This will also eventually lead to players developing a lot of skills on their own and be able to control the pace of the game. You must know that this process of distribution is applicable only to players who have made some advancement in their training.

The kids who have just started playing soccer should not get involved in soccer practice games. Their soccer drills should be such that they play for enjoyment than to follow rules. Their only attention should be on playing and not working on the technique.

When you teach the players the process of distribution, it is vital that they know how to maintain balance with the ball. The player who has the ball must look up while retaining the possession of the ball and decide on where to pass it.

The coach must teach the players to develop space around the player with the ball so that he gets adequate room and shield to pass the ball. A 4v4 game is the best way to teach such tactics.

Also, the coach must teach his players about various positions such as forward, defender, right flank, left flank. The players should know and understand these positions and the coach must call these positions by name during the training.

You must be patient while the kids try to get used to these soccer exercises. They may take some time in learning these things.

Soccer Drills: 5 Simple Steps To The Basics

Published by admin under Timed Finals

Soccer drills

You might disagree, but hear me out on this. When it comes to soccer drills, it is important that kids are first trained on the basic skills of the game so that they can get a feel of the game. This soccer training should precede the training the kids on more complex components of soccer or the correct method of playing on field.

As a coach, it becomes your responsibility to ensure that players begin with hitting the right chord. For this reason, coach your players on every important soccer skill forming the basis of the game. Discussed below are some basics of the game that every budding player must know.

Teaching the dribbling and shooting techniques to the players: Dribbling and shooting cover the two basic techniques in the game of soccer. To become a successful player, these skills have a major role to play in their game. But, for teaching these soccer exercises, you should see that all preparations are made in advance.

Starting from one end of the field put more than a few players over the field and line up all players in a straight line.

Now signal the players to start. Running around the field, they would try to grab the ball by their feet as they dribble and shoot the ball in the goal located at the opposite end of the field. When they practice these two soccer drills on a daily basis, they’ll be able to learn them fast.

Soccer drills

Passing the ball and following directions: These soccer skills will help the players to learn the value of playing in a team. After all, soccer is a team game and it should be evenly dispersed between all the players. It’ll be extremely difficult for the players to play as one team when they can’t follow simple instructions or can’t learn the skill of passing the ball amongst them.

There is a simple drill that can be used to teach them about passing the ball and following directions. At the start, the entire team should form a single line at either end of the field. Place one team member stand in front of the single line at a distance of 5-10 feet.

As you blow the whistle, first person in row will try to catch hold of the ball form other team members on the field. As soon as they are told to stop, the player who has the ball would pass it to the player who is first in the line. In this soccer practice, players will get an opportunity to practice listening and following instructions.

Handling the Ball: Since you’re the coach, teach the players the skill to manage the ball with their feet and with other parts of their body as well. This way they’ll be able to perform more spontaneously on the field. An easy way for players to do it is by practicing to stop the ball with the back or bouncing the ball using knees or the head.

Soccer drills like these help in developing players that become match winners and make their way to learning more difficult components of the game.
